  • Patent number: 9498735
    Abstract: A variety of sets of interconnecting plane tiles having shapes, patterns on the faces of some of the tiles and interconnecting elements to be able to construct all 17 plane periodic patterns, the five Platonic solids and the thirteen Archimedean solids are described. The tiles include connectors that enable constructing plane patterns as well as three-dimensional solids.

  • Patent number: 9070300
    Abstract: This invention relates to interlocking rectangular and triangular tiles for use in tessellating a plane, teaching certain aspects of geometry and trigonometry, and creating decorative objects. The tiles comprising the invention, some with a design on them, tessellate the plane with periodic and non-periodic patterns based on the design as the basic unit of repetition. In particular; the tiles can be assembled to create any of the 17 possible plane periodic patterns. The tiles of the present invention can be used as a teaching tool for a partially structured exploration of plane periodic patterns, and for learning the mathematical notation for these patterns. They can also be used for teaching basic geometry to younger children through exploratory play. This invention can also be used as a stencil assembly, so that the patterns created can be transferred to a plane surface and used as decorations.
